【解题思路】这是一道不错的数论题目,可以学到很多东西,比如说将指数很大的数进行二进制处理,还有就是判断素数和伪素数。最有用的知识点是:1、如果p是奇数,则有(a.^p)mod(m)==((a%m)*(a.^(p-1)%m)%m成立;2、如果p是偶数,则有a.^p==a.^(p/2)*a.^(p/2)。也许可以说这两个结论人人都知道,但用起来就不是那么一回事了。#
原创 2022-08-05 15:48:11
27阅读
Pseudoprime numbersTime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 2529    Accepted Submission(s): 1055Problem DescriptionFe
原创 2022-09-26 14:39:14
55阅读
问题链接:POJ3641 UVA11287 HDU1905 Pseudoprime numbers。问题简述:参见上述链接。问题分析:这个问题是验证伪素数问题。p是伪素数的条件是,p不是素数并且满足ap = a (mod p)。伪素数是数论中与费尔马小定理有关的一个重...
转载 2017-05-20 00:17:00
90阅读
2评论
#include#include#define ll long longll mod;bool Judge(int x){ for(int i=2;i0) { if(n&1) { ans*=ret; ans%=mod; } ret=(ret*ret)%mod; n>>=1; } return ans;}int main(){ int p,a; while(scanf("%d %d",&p,&a)!=EOF) { if(p==0...
转载 2013-09-26 16:21:00
105阅读
题意:a的p次方p取模等于a,且p不是素数,就输出yes;#include<iostream>#include<cstdio>#include<algorithm>#include<cmath>#include<cstring>#define ll long longusing namespace std;ll powermod(ll a
原创 2022-10-19 16:13:14
22阅读
题意:给出膨胀指数,加热温度,杆子的原长度,问加热后的杆子两端点位置不变,弯曲成弧,圆心的位置。分析:二分答案,二分查找圆心位置,根据圆心位置计算出弧长与原弧长比较,不知道为什么wa那么多次。View Code #include #include #include #include #include usingnamespace std;#define eps 1.0e-8double c, l1, n;double cal(double b){ double a = l1 /2; double d = sqrt(a * a + b * b); double h = a * ...
转载 2011-07-02 21:22:00
24阅读
2评论
#include <iostream> //二分查找#include <math.h>using namespace std;#define precisions 1e-5int main(){ double l,n,c,a; double begin,end,mid,r,angle; while(cin>>l>>n>>c&&l>=0) { a=l/2; begin=0;end=a; l=(1.0+n*c)*l; while(end-begin>precisions) { mid=(end+begin)/2
转载 2011-07-22 14:54:00
27阅读
2评论
/** <p>给你两个 <code>m x n</code> 的二进制矩阵 <code>grid1</code> 和 <code>grid2</code> ,它们只包含 <code>0</code> (表示水域)和 <code>1</code> (表示陆地)。一个 <strong>岛屿</stron
原创 2022-07-05 09:34:15
26阅读
1. 引言IEEE802.11s定义了基于无线全连接的网络,每个节点可以与多个节点建立连接,是网状(Mesh)组网的网络。 EasyMesh是WFA基于IEEE802.11s制定的用于不同AP相互连接的应用标准(最新版本为V5.0)。这个标准定义了不同厂家的AP相互连接、控制的协议,使不同品牌的Mesh路由器也能组网。不同于IEEE802.11s定义的Mesh网络,EasyMesh定义的网络为树形
/**<p>给你两个 <code>m x n</code> 的二进制矩阵 <code>grid1</code> 和 <code>grid2</code> ,它们只包含 <code>0</code> (表示水域)和 <code>1</code> (表示陆地)。一个 &l
原创 2022-07-05 09:32:25
19阅读
(1) 角度→弧度公式 θr = 1/2*s 3 4 (2) 三角函数公式 sinθ= 1/2*L/r 5 6 (3) 勾股定理 r^2 – ( r – h)^2 = (1/2*L)^2
转载 2013-02-26 19:20:00
54阅读
2评论
DescriptionWhen a thin rod of length L is heated n degrees, it expands to a new length L'=(1+n*C)*L, where C is the coefficient of heat expansion.
转载 2012-03-14 02:20:00
13阅读
2评论
<?phpnamespace tools\jwt;use Lcobucci\JWT\Builder;use Lcobucci\JWT\Parser;use Lcobucci\JWT\Signer\Hmac\Sha256;use Lcobucci\JWT\ValidationData;class To ...
转载 2021-07-29 15:32:00
119阅读
2评论
遍历grid2,如果在遍历一个岛屿的过程中没有超过相应的grid1的1的范围,说明遍历到了一个子岛屿,否则不是子岛屿 int st[510][510]; int dx[] = {0, 1, 0, -1}; int dy[] = {1, 0, -1, 0}; int valid; class Solu ...
转载 2021-08-22 16:54:00
51阅读
2评论
        网管报文的作用:        要理解网管报文的作用,我们需要先明白车上的节点------“Node”。        所谓节点,对一台新能源汽车来说,车上有着几十个节点,如OBC节点、VCU节点、BMS节点。如果这些不知道
1 /* 2 二分 + 几何 3 弧长L, 圆半径R, 弧度 q, L=R*q; 4 二分:
转载 2014-07-29 22:56:00
55阅读
2评论
DescriptionWhen a thin rod of length L is heated n degrees, it expands to a new len
原创 2023-02-17 16:53:30
93阅读
数字信号在传输中往往由于各种原因,使得在传送的数据流中产生误码,从而使接收端产生图象跳跃、不连续、出现马赛克等现象。所以通过信道编码这一环节,对数码流进行相应的处理,使系统具有一定的纠错能力和抗干扰能力,可极大地避免码流传送中误码的发生。误码的处理技术有纠错、交织、线性内插等。     提高数据传输效率,降低误码率是信道编码的任务。信道编码的本质是增加通信的
You are given two m x n binary matrices grid1 and grid2 containing only 0's (representing water) and 1's (representing land). An island is a group of  ...
转载 2021-07-16 07:46:00
86阅读
2评论
写在前面:本文是《ploygon mesh processing》的读书笔记难点:必须直观,但数学原理复杂。必须以足够高效和健壮的方式实现,以允许交互应用程序。技术方向:surface-based deformations(1-4) 位于原始曲面上,通过在三角形网格上计算得到。优点: 这些方法提供了高度的控制,因为每个顶点都可以被单独约束。缺点: 计算的鲁棒性和效率受到原始曲面S的网格复杂度和三角
  • 1
  • 2
  • 3
  • 4
  • 5